How to Run a Successful Airbnb Business In a world where flexibility, independence, and passive income are more attainable than ever, short-term rentals have opened a door to life-changing opportunity. How to Run a Successful Airbnb Business is your complete guide to building, managing, and scaling a profitable hosting operation—whether you're launching your first listing or expanding a growing portfolio. Through detailed insights and real-world strategies, this book walks you through every critical phase of the Airbnb journey. You'll learn how to make smart property decisions, create irresistible listings, master the guest experience, and protect your business with the right legal and financial safeguards. It goes beyond surface-level advice, offering step-by-step guidance grounded in professional practice and tested results. You don't need to be a real estate expert or a hospitality veteran to succeed—just a clear roadmap and the right mindset. This book delivers both. Inside This Book, You'll Discover: Understanding the Airbnb Platform Setting Up Your Space for Success Creating a Standout Listing Pricing Strategies that Maximize Revenue Delivering an Exceptional Guest Experience Handling Reviews and Guest Communication Scaling Your Airbnb Business Each chapter offers insights you can apply immediately—whether you're seeking financial freedom, a flexible lifestyle, or simply a more effective way to manage your short-term rental.
